WebTime Management. Punctuality is highly valued in Canada. It is advised to arrive 5 to 10 minutes before the meeting. You should expect the meeting time to adhere closely to schedule, both in its start and duration. Greetings and Titles. Greetings start with a handshake, followed by a personal and company introduction. WebJan 2, 2024 · It's acceptable to send a promotional gift to someone or some business with whom you've not previously had contact. However, be sure to leave a note of introduction that is thorough and explains clearly why you've sent them a gift. And be sure to add your contact information.
